Biological Background: GDF15 Function and Localization
- GDF15, also known as MIC-1, NAG-1, PLAB, PTGFB, and PDF, is a secreted member of the TGF-beta superfamily with hormone and cytokine activities.
- Acts as a hormone produced in response to various stresses to trigger an aversive response (nausea, vomiting, loss of appetite) via brain circuits, promoting avoidance behavior. Related references: PMID:23468844, PMID:24971956, PMID:28846097, PMID:30639358, PMID:33589633, PMID:38092039
- Binds selectively to its receptor GFRAL on neurons in the brainstem (area postrema and nucleus tractus solitarius), activating downstream emergency circuits. Related references: PMID:28846097, PMID:28846098, PMID:28846099, PMID:28953886
- Suppresses appetite and promotes weight loss; contributes to the anorectic effects of metformin, though the quantitative contribution is debated. Related references: PMID:31875646, PMID:37060902, PMID:36001956
- Overproduced in many cancers and drives cancer cachexia; anticancer drugs such as camptothecin or cisplatin induce GDF15, leading to nausea and malnutrition. Related references: PMID:32661391
- High fetal-origin GDF15 levels during pregnancy are associated with nausea and vomiting; maternal sensitivity depends on pre-pregnancy GDF15 exposure. Related references: PMID:38092039
- Promotes metabolic adaptation and tissue tolerance during systemic inflammation by modulating lipid metabolism and inhibiting leukocyte integrin activation. Related references: PMID:31402172
- Subcellular location: Secreted. Highly expressed in placenta, with lower levels in prostate, colon, and kidney. Related references: PMID:9348093, PMID:28572090, PMID:29046435, PMID:37060902
Experimental Guidance and Technical Tips
- The immunogen corresponds to a peptide within the propeptide region (amino acids 100-200); therefore, the antibody is expected to detect the full-length precursor (~34 kDa) on Western blot. The mature secreted form (~12.5 kDa) may not be recognized if the epitope is removed during processing.
- For Western blot, use reducing conditions and load positive control lysates from GDF15-expressing tissues (e.g., placenta, prostate, colon) or cell lines. Optimal antibody dilution should be determined empirically.
- For ELISA, the antibody can be evaluated as a capture or detection reagent; validate pairing with a different anti-GDF15 clone for sandwich assays. Serum or plasma samples are appropriate given the secreted nature of the target.
- Keep samples cold and avoid repeated freeze-thaw cycles to preserve antigen integrity.
